The APC by Schneider Electric 3827GY-25 is a 25-foot Category 5 Unshielded Twisted Pair (UTP) patch cable designed for standard Ethernet networking. It terminates in RJ45 Male connectors on both ends, wired to the 568B standard for reliable connectivity in commercial and residential network deployments. This cable is suitable for connecting network devices such as switches, routers, computers, and IP cameras where data rates up to 100 Mbps are sufficient.
This cable is universally compatible with any network device featuring standard RJ45 Ethernet ports. It is suitable for use with network switches, routers, IP cameras, network video recorders (NVRs), and workstations that utilize standard Ethernet connections. The 568B wiring ensures interoperability with most commercial networking equipment.
This is a standard patch cable; no specialized installation tools are required beyond basic cable management. Ensure the cable is not subjected to excessive pulling force or sharp bends that could compromise the internal conductors. The operating temperature range for standard Ethernet cables should be observed; avoid extreme heat or cold.
